Did you know?
“Push” delves into the emotional turmoil of a relationship where one partner feels manipulated and controlled.
The lyrics, such as “I wanna push you around, well I will, well I will,” suggest a struggle for dominance, but also reveal underlying vulnerability and self-awareness.
The repeated line “I wanna take you for granted” hints at taking the partner for granted, yet the tone suggests regret and internal conflict.
The song captures the tension between wanting to assert control and the fear of losing the relationship.
The raw, emotional delivery by Rob Thomas underscores the pain and confusion inherent in such dynamics, making it a poignant reflection on the darker aspects of love and power.
